Hydroxychloroquine (HCQ), an antimalarial and anti-inflammatory drug, has been shown to inhibit SARS-COV-2 infection in vitro and tested in clinical studies.
Severe acute respiratory syndrome coronavirus 2 (SARS- COV-2) is a newly identified pathogen causing the coronavirus disease 2019 (COVID-19) pandemic.

The integrated tools for data processing, non-compartmental analysis (NCA), PK/PD modeling, post-analysis statistics, table creation, and graphics create an all-in-one collaboration workbench for analysts, reviewers, medical writers, and quality assurance team members. Phoenix WinNonlin is the industry standard for the analysis of pharmacokinetic and pharmacodynamics data. For more information, visit What is Phoenix WinNonlin?
